WebThe tuna fishery is the largest of Papua New Guinea’s fisheries and represents a balance of both domestic industry development and foreign Distant Water Fishing Nations (DWFN) access arrangements. ... Since 1995, participation in the PNG longline fishery, under a domestication policy, has been restricted to national or citizen companies, with ... WebPapua New Guinea’s fisheries industry is the latest sector to come under the scrutiny of the new Marape-Davis Government. The Minister Assisting the Prime Minister, Manasseh Makiba, announced a review of existing policies at the biennial Pacific Tuna Forum in Port Moresby in September.
